The grief that is but feigning, / And weeps melodious tears / Of delicate complaining / From self-indulgent years; / The mirth that is but madness, / And has no inward gladness / Beneath its laughter straining, / To capture thoughtless ears; / The love that is but passion / Of amber-scented lust; / The doubt that is but fashion; / The faith that has no trust; / These Thamyris disperses, / In the Valley of Vain Verses / Below the Mount Parnassian --
And they crumble into dust.
